Itinerary

  • Visit the serene Saghmosavank Monastery, perched on the edge of the Kasagh River gorge. This 13th-century spiritual haven offers a glimpse into medieval Armenian monastic life and provides panoramic views of the surrounding landscapes.

  • Begin your adventure at the Alphabet Monument, a tribute to the Armenian script and its creator, Mesrop Mashtots. Each intricately carved letter symbolizes Armenia's cultural heritage and linguistic pride, set against the stunning backdrop of Mount Aragats.

  • Perched dramatically on the edge of the Kasagh Gorge, Hovhannavank Monastery is a stunning 4thu201313th century Armenian monastic complex rich in history and architecture. Once an important spiritual and educational center, it features intricately carved stone crosses (khachkars), ancient inscriptions, and a striking main church dedicated to St. John the Baptist. Visitors are rewarded with breathtaking panoramic views of the canyon and surrounding landscapes, making it a perfect blend of cultural heritage and natural beauty.
